Best macular vitelliform dystrophy is a childhood macular dystrophy autosomal dominantly inherited due to problems in the VMD2/BEST 1 gene on chromosome 11 encoding for the protein BESTROPHIN. The disease is RPE dystophy due to problemative conductance across the chloride channel controlled by the bestrophin gene present on the basolateral aspect of the RPE.
it evolves through 6 clinical stages namely ; previtelliform stage, vitelliform stage, pseudohypopyon stage, vitellodisrupted stage and atrophic stage . 20% of the patients can have thier course complicated with a choroidal neovascular memberane.
The common investigative modalities for the best disease are the OCT, Electrooculogram ( decreased ardens ratio), ERG, FFA, Fundus autoflourescence.
